Y546 JFB is a 2001 Fiat Scudo in White with a 1,867c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 64.7%.

Across all 2001 Fiat Scudo models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.5% with a typical mileage of 95,277 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Fiat Scudo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 25,288 recorded failures. If you're considering buying Y546 JFB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Fiat Scudo typ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 25 years old, this Fiat Scudo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
